Duties
Assist attorneys with case preparation by conducting thorough research using tools such as Lexis-Nexis.
Manage case files, including data entry, organization, and maintenance of legal documents.
Draft legal documents, correspondence, and reports to ensure accuracy and clarity.
Maintain effective communication with clients, attorneys, and court personnel through professional phone and email etiquette.
Support project management by tracking deadlines and coordinating schedules for meetings and court appearances.
Perform administrative tasks such as filing, scanning documents, and maintaining office supplies.
